foretold

英 [fɔːˈtəʊld]

美 [fɔːrˈtoʊld]

v.  (尤指用魔力)预知,预言
foretell的过去分词和过去式

过去分词:foretold 过去式:foretold 

BNC.32627

柯林斯词典


  • Foretoldis the past tense and past participle offoretell.

    双语例句

    • But take ye heed: behold, I have foretold you all things.
      你们要谨慎。看哪,凡事我都豫先告诉你们了。
    • He foretold the world war.
      他预言了世界大战的爆发。
    • Christ: the messiah, as foretold by the prophets of the old testament.
      救世主:《旧约》中的先知们预言的救世主。
    • The witch foretold that she would marry prince.
      女巫预言她将嫁给王子。
    • The gypsy had foretold that the boy would die.
      那吉普赛人曾经预言这男孩儿得夭折。
    • Later, in the torrid Hainan, I had relative accurately foretold the date of my northward return.
      后来,在炎热的海南,我相对准确地预言了自己向北的归期。
    • No one could have foretold such a freak accident.
      谁也无法预言会发生如此奇特的事故。
    • They foretold the future through observing the flight of birds and examining the entrails of sacrificed animals.
      他们通过观察鸟类的飞翔和检查献祭动物的内脏来预测未来。
    • Nothing he saw was foretold in the bible.
      他的预言在圣经里并没有提到。
    • Indeed, all the prophets from Samuel on, as many as have spoken, have foretold these days.
      从撒母耳以来的众先知,凡说预言的,也都说到这些日子。
